Overordnede kursusmål:

The overall objective of this course is to introduce the students to advanced methods in the areas of image and video coding, motion estimation, video processing and related areas.

At the summer school invited speakers, at an international level, will give presentations reviewing different areas. Moreover, the attendees have the opportunity of giving presentations and working in groups.


Læringsmål:

En studerende, der fuldt ud har opfyldt kursets mål, vil kunne:
  • Identify relevant techniques from other fields related to their project
  • Understand video coding including distributed video coding
  • Understand variational methods
  • Understand PDE based image coding
  • Understand processing for backlight dimming
  • Analyze novel advanced methods for their project work
  • Establish connections between image/video coding and processing techniques
  • Communicate advanced substance to students from a related field
